Introduction

In the realm of horror cinema, some stories linger longer than others, and a select few find a way to entwine fear with human emotions in such a way that they leave a lasting impression. Shortcut (2020) is one such film that succeeds in doing so. Directed by Alessio Liguori, this Italian horror film follows a group of high school students who find themselves in a nightmarish scenario when their ordinary bus ride turns into a fight for survival. With a setting that is both isolated and claustrophobic, Shortcut is a sharp reminder that sometimes, the road less traveled is the most dangerous.

Plot Summary

The story centers on a group of five high school students who are on their way home from school. When their bus driver is forced to take a detour through a remote countryside road, the trip quickly takes a turn for the worse. An unexpected breakdown leaves them stranded near a dark, abandoned tunnel. Without cell service, no signs of civilization nearby, and nightfall fast approaching, the group is left with no choice but to find a way out of their predicament.

As the night deepens, it becomes evident that they are not alone. The tunnel harbors an ancient, bloodthirsty creature that feeds on fear and is drawn to movement. As the students try to escape, they find themselves confronting not only terror but their own personal fears, testing their courage, trust, and unity.

The Creature and Atmosphere

One of the film’s standout elements is the creature design. The monster in Shortcut is not just an ordinary beast but a being that thrives on fear, staying hidden until it’s too late. This clever design enhances the tension throughout the film, as the creature’s presence is always felt, even when it’s unseen. This approach allows for a more psychological form of horror, where the real terror isn’t just the threat of the creature, but the growing paranoia and sense of helplessness among the characters.

The film does an excellent job at building atmosphere. The isolated setting of the abandoned tunnel is perfect for this type of horror, with its dark, oppressive feel that constantly reminds the audience of how alone the characters are. The combination of claustrophobic tension and the unknown lurking in the dark is what drives the horror, making every sound and movement feel like a potential death sentence.

Character Development and Tension

Despite the film’s focus on horror, it never loses sight of its human element. Each of the five students has their own distinct personalities and fears, which become pivotal as the story unfolds. The tension among them grows as the danger escalates, and their survival ultimately depends on their ability to trust each other and work as a team.

The characters’ growth throughout the film is subtle but effective. Their initial reluctance to work together slowly morphs into a more cohesive group dynamic as they realize that unity is their only hope. This shift is not just for plot convenience but is tied to the emotional core of the film, where the characters’ internal struggles are just as dangerous as the external threat they face.

Final Thoughts

Shortcut (2020) is a film that masterfully blends psychological and physical horror. It’s not just about the creature lurking in the tunnel, but about the human condition when faced with life-and-death situations. The film’s pacing is tight, keeping the audience engaged with a constant sense of dread. The combination of a chilling atmosphere, strong character arcs, and an unpredictable monster creates an experience that is both terrifying and thought-provoking.

While it may not break new ground in terms of the genre, it proves that a well-executed horror film doesn’t need to reinvent the wheel to be effective.
